There are great individual differences in breast development among girls. Some girls begin to develop breasts when they are only 8 or 9 years old, while some girls do not begin to develop breasts until they are 16 years old or older. Most girls begin to develop breasts before their first menstrual period, around 9 to 14 years old. When the breasts are just beginning to develop, the mammary glands that make up the breasts and the surrounding fat tissue form a small, button-like bulge over the nipple and the areola that surrounds it, causing the nipple and areola to bulge and the nipple to begin to grow larger. The nipple then becomes more prominent, gradually becomes fuller, and finally develops into the shape of an adult breast. The rate at which breasts develop also varies from person to person. Some girls start developing breasts later but develop faster, while some girls develop breasts earlier but develop more slowly. 2. Girls whose breasts develop early are often embarrassed about it and try to hide their breast protrusions deliberately, such as lowering their heads and hunching their chests when walking, or wearing tight clothes to bind their breasts, which restricts the normal development of the breasts and thorax. Breast binding will compress the breasts and nipples, causing breast hypoplasia, which will cause difficulties in lactation and breastfeeding in the future and can also easily cause breast diseases. In fact, girls who develop breasts early and have larger breasts are also affected by many factors. Some girls are fatter, so their breasts appear fuller, while some develop larger breasts due to genetic factors, nutritional conditions, climate, etc. However, breast development usually stops after a certain age. Large breasts do not have any adverse effects on the body, nor do they reflect a person's ideology, morality, and consciousness, so there is no need to worry about breast development. 3. Some girls are worried and uneasy because their breasts have not started to develop or are small. More sensitive girls may easily find that their breasts are not as full as those of some of their peers in public bathrooms or during group activities. They may doubt whether their breast development is normal, and may also worry about whether it will affect their fertility in the future. 4. The size of breast development is affected not only by hormones, but also by genetics, environmental factors, nutritional conditions, body fatness, physical exercise and other factors. Small breasts may also be related to the early or late development. In fact, as long as the development of reproductive organs and menstruation are normal, it will not affect the breastfeeding function and fertility in adulthood. Generally speaking, the early or late start of breast development does not affect the speed of future development, nor does it affect the size and shape of the breasts in adulthood, so there is no need to worry about late development or small breasts. Of course, if the breasts have not started to develop for a long time after menarche, it is necessary to go to the hospital for a check-up and ask the doctor to diagnose whether it is physiological or pathological so that countermeasures can be taken. |
